Enquiries and specification requests

We receive the name, work email and company you provide. Quote requests may also include a phone number, installation postcode, selected booth types and project details. We use this information to respond, provide requested specifications and quotations, and discuss your project. Sending a request does not sign you up to a newsletter or ongoing marketing subscription. A sales representative may contact you about your request.

Sales follow-ups and stopping emails

For corporate business enquiries, we may send up to three automated follow-up emails over the week after providing the requested guide. These may include product advice, availability and pricing offers. We record the request, the privacy notice shown and email delivery and stop status; a privacy acknowledgement is not recorded as marketing consent. You can stop these emails using the unsubscribe link in each follow-up or by replying. Requesting another guide does not restart a stopped sequence.

Our sales mailbox connection checks message headers to detect replies and hand the conversation to a person. It does not need message bodies or attachments for this check. We keep a suppression record to honour opt-outs. You may also object to direct marketing by contacting us.

When you request a specification sheet or quote, we share your submitted enquiry details internally with our sales team through Slack. This includes your name, company, email, relevant product and, for quotes, any selected booth types, phone number, installation postcode and written message you provide.

When a first reply is detected, we may notify our sales team through Slack using the enquiry name, company, email address and handover status. The notification does not include the email body or attachments.

Where you request steps towards a contract with us, we use your information to take those steps. For business enquiries made on behalf of an organisation, we rely on our legitimate interests in responding to the enquiry and providing our services. We also process technical request data where necessary to operate and protect the website.

Analytics and advertising

With your permission, Google Analytics measures visits and successful enquiries. Advertising measurement, when enabled, helps us understand which Google Ads lead to enquiries. Optional storage and advertising personalisation are controlled by your cookie choices. We do not include your name, contact details or message in website analytics events, and do not enable enhanced conversions that upload your contact details.

Read our cookie policy and use Cookie settings in the footer to change or withdraw optional consent. Withdrawing consent does not affect earlier lawful processing.

Service providers and international processing

Vercel hosts and delivers this website. Resend processes enquiry emails, including requested guides and sales follow-ups. Enquiries are handled by our team through our business email service. Neon provides database storage for request, delivery and suppression records. Google provides our business email and, where you permit it, analytics and advertising services. Slack processes our internal enquiry and sales handover notifications. These providers may process information outside the UK. Applicable provider data-processing terms and international-transfer safeguards govern this processing.

How long information is kept

We keep enquiry information for as long as needed to respond, manage the resulting business relationship and meet applicable legal or record-keeping obligations. Relevant factors include whether you become a customer, whether a query or dispute remains open, and any legal requirement to retain records. You can ask us about retention of a specific enquiry or request deletion where applicable. Analytics event retention and cookie expiry are configured separately; our cookie policy explains browser storage.

Google Analytics user-level and event-level data are configured for two-month retention, without extending user-level retention on a new visit. Aggregated standard reports may be retained longer.

Your rights

Depending on the circumstances, you may ask to access, correct, erase or receive a portable copy of your personal information, restrict processing, or object to processing based on legitimate interests. Contact us using the email above. You can also complain to the Information Commissioner’s Office. Some rights have conditions or exceptions.
